David J. LaMonda

BAKERSFIELD: David J. LaMonda, age 71, passed away unexpectedly on Thursday, June 2, 2022 at the Northwestern Medical Center.

He was born in St. Albans on April 29, 1951 to the late Wilfred & Marie (Bergeron) LaMonda. David married Joyce (Hammond) on July 27, 1973.

David was the type of guy who would make friends everywhere he went. He loved joking around, being goofy, being silly, and would never miss an activity his children or grandchildren were participating in. David was a “putterer” and always kept moving. His lawn was always perfectly manicured, even if that meant bringing out his shop vac to get the job done.

He worked as a maintenance technician for machinery for most of his career. He spent over 25 years with IBM, and retired from Ben & Jerry’s. David could fix just about anything and he was passionate about everything he did. He will be remembered as a loving husband and father, and for his love for sweets, chocolate, and Diet Pepsi! His “Papa treats” are sure to carry on in the family.
